Digital Marketer Roles in 2025

Before we delve into the digital marketer roles, let’s first define what a digital marketer is.

Think of a digital marketer who works behind the brand that you see everything online – catchy Instagram posts, YouTube ads, email offers, and blog content. Their main goal is to help businesses grow by connecting with the right people at the right time on the right platform – YouTube, Facebook, Instagram, LinkedIn, Google, Bing, or Pinterest.

They’re responsible for:

  • Creating engaging content that speaks directly to the target audience.
  • Optimizing websites and blogs for search engines.
  • Running paid ad campaigns on platforms like Google, Meta, and other social media platforms.
  • Tracking results using tools like Google Analytics, heatmaps, and even AI-driven insights.
  • Testing and tweaking strategies based on real-time data because what worked last month might not work today.

Moreover, digital marketers often work closely with other teams – designers, content writers, video editors, and even coders to ensure every campaign looks great, runs smoothly, and performs well.

Paid Advertising

Paid advertising is one of the fastest and most powerful ways for businesses to get noticed in today’s crowded online space. Through Instagram Story ads and Google search results, you can get customers for your brand – that’s the power of paid advertising.

It all starts with deep market research. A digital marketer looks into data to figure out:

Who is the target audience?

What do they care about?

Where do they spend their time online?

Are they scrolling on Instagram reels, searching on Google, or checking on YouTube? Through this, a digital marketer can choose the right platform to run the campaign.

Once the audience is defined, the marketer selects the best ad platform – it could be Google Ads, Meta Ads (Facebook and Instagram), LinkedIn for B2B, or other ad networks.

Next, they come up with the strategy:

  • Set clear goals – awareness, traffic, leads, sales.
  • Craft compelling ad creatives through eye-catching visuals with sharp copy and strong CTA.
  • Choose the right ad format like carousel, video, display, or search.
  • Next, manage the budgets smartly by ensuring maximum ROI for every rupee spent.

But it doesn’t stop after launching the ad. Digital marketers closely track performance metrics like click-through rates (CTR), cost per click (CPC), conversions, and return on ad spend (ROAS).

And when things aren’t working? They make changes to the headline, image, or retargeting a different segment.

With the rise of AI tools, marketers now use AI-driven platforms to run A/B tests to predict ad fatigue and generate ad copies that resonate better with customers.

Copywriting

Copywriting is one of the most creative and powerful roles in digital marketing. It’s not just about writing words but about choosing the right words that make people stop scrolling, pay attention, and take action.

Copywriting is about words that convert. Whether it’s a headline, a product description, or an email – great copy can spark interest, build trust, and drive results.

For example, let’s say a copywriter is promoting a new running shoe. They wouldn’t just say, “Buy our new shoes.” Instead, they’d come up with “Wear it – Step into comfort with every run.”

Because digital marketer roles need to evoke both emotion and purchase. Today, marketers are the voice of the brand, shaping how a company sounds across all pain points. They write persuasive website content that draws you in and gently guides you toward the “Buy Now” button.

Content Marketing

Content marketing is a long-term strategy focused on creating valuable, relevant, and consistent content to attract and engage a clearly defined audience. And when done right, it builds trust, loyalty, and conversions.

Content marketing includes videos, podcasts, infographics, email newsletters, social media threads, and even interactive tools like quizzes. But the goal is to solve problems, answer questions, entertain, and educate your customers

While copywriting focuses more on immediate persuasion, content marketing nurtures relationships and establishes your brand as a trusted voice in your industry.

Here’s what digital marketer roles include:

  • Research deeply to find out what the audience actually wants.
  • Plan and create high-quality content to create well-researched blog posts, engaging reels, and carousels.
  • Track performance using tools like Google Analytics, Search Console, and social insights to see what’s working and what needs tweaking.

Moreover, content marketing delivers value first, earns attention, and builds a loyal audience that comes back for repurchase.

Search Engine Optimization (SEO)

A SEO expert helps your brand to stay visible without paying for ads. Rather than relying on paid promotions, SEO focuses on organic strategies to increase a website’s visibility. Moreover, a digital marketer understands what your audience is searching for, and then your content shows up when they hit that search bar.

SEO isn’t just about stuffing keywords, but creating high-quality content.

Here’s what a digital marketer roles includes in SEO:

  • Conducts keyword research to discover what people are searching for – through tools like Google Keyword Planner.
  • Optimizing titles, headers, meta descriptions, image alt texts, and even URL structure to make content both customer and search engine friendly.
  • Improves website structure and speed because Google loves a fast and mobile-friendly website to easy to navigate.
  • Builds backlinks from trusted websites to improve authority and credibility.
  • Analyzes metrics using tools like Google Analytics, Search Console, and heatmaps to understand what’s working, what isn’t, and where improvements can be made.

Now, SEO is getting even more dynamic. With AI search assistants, voice search, and zero-click results, digital marketers now optimize for conversational queries, local intent, and featured snippets.

Social Media Marketing

If your brand isn’t on social media in 2025, you’re invisible. It’s more than just posting pictures.

You can create a connection between your brand and your audience on platforms like Instagram, Facebook, LinkedIn, or X.

Here’s what digital marketer roles include:

  • Craft platform-specific content like reels for Instagram, polls for LinkedIn, or snappy tweets for X.
  • Schedule and plan content calendars to keep the brand active.
  • Engage with followers by responding to comments to build a connection with customers.
  • Run targeted paid ad campaigns using advanced audience filters to reach exactly what they want.
  • Track performance through analytics tools and make changes based on engagement, reach, shares, and ROI.

Skills Needed For Digital Marketer Roles

Let’s explore some of the most in-demand and valuable skills every digital marketer should master in 2025.

Problem-Solving

Things move fast in digital marketing, and they change according to the trends and people’s ideology. Whether it’s a drop in engagement or a sudden change in platform algorithms, digital marketers need to think quickly and act smarter.

As a digital marketer, you need to approach challenges with a strategic mindset by staying calm under pressure and turning obstacles into opportunities.

User-Centricity

User-centricity means creating strategies, content, and experiences that truly speak to the audience’s needs, preferences, and behaviors.

What are they searching for?

What content do they enjoy?

What problems can your brand solve for them?

This mindset leads to more personalized, relevant content, which not only increases engagement but also builds trust and long-term loyalty.

Persuasion

Digital marketers know how to communicate value. Persuasion guides people toward action – not with pressure, but with storytelling and authenticity. You can craft a good headline, copy, great content, or CTA to convert and build emotional connections to bring trust.

Adaptability

Digital marketing changes fast – what worked yesterday might not work today. Whether it’s a new platform, a shift in algorithms, or a change in user behavior, digital marketers need to stay flexible and adapt their strategies in real-time.

Marketers who embrace change and continue learning are the ones who thrive. So, stay with current AI tools and trends to ensure your strategies, so you can stay relevant and impactful.
